CEC to sell 45% holding in CNCATV

China Electronics Corporation (CEC), a key state-owned conglomerate under the direct administration of China’s cabinet and the nation’s largest state-owned IT company, has put the 45% stake it holds in China Cable TV (CNCATV) on sale for US$64.40 million (RMB450 million), ...
